♠ Spit In The Ocean
Each player receives four cards, instead of five. The fifth card is placed face up in the middle of the table, and is shared by all the players in the hand, much like a board card in Hold'em.

The face up card is also Wild, and any held cards of that rank also become Wild.

Play proceeds as in a normal Draw Poker game. Player are allowed to draw four cards during the redraw.

♠ Cincinnati
Players all receive five cards as the hand starts, and an additional five-card "ghost" hand is dealt in as well.

A card from the ghost hand is turned up, followed by a round of betting. This takes place repeatedly until all five cards are overturned.

Players then use any combination of cards from their own hand and the face up cards to create a poker hand.

This game is sometimes played hi/lo, where the pot is plit between the highest and lowest hands at the table.

♠ Cincinnati Liz
Played the same as Cincinnati, excpet a wild card is added to the game. The wild card can either be the third exposed card, or the lowest of the exposed cards. Whichever method is used, it must be agreed upon in advance, obviously.

♠ Low Draw
Begins as Jacks-or-Bettor, except is the hand is "passed out" (noboday can begin betting because they do not hold a hand of one pair of Jacks, or Better), the game proceeds as a game of Lowball.

♠ Brag
Is a three card poker game. The cards are dealt, and the dealer antes. Other players must then either call or raise. At the showdown, only pairs or three-of-a-kind are recognized.
There are also three wild cards in the deck. Ace Diamonds, Jack Clubs, 9 Diamonds. A pair that uses a wild card loses ties to a natural pair of the same rank.

♠ American Brag
In this version of the game, all jacks and nines are wild. Pairs or Three-of-a-Kind hands formed using the wild cards outrank natural cards.
